Enigma 09-12-2012 01:38 PM

It is Glaucus atlanticus.

Despite their often dubious content, here's the wiki article:
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Glaucus_atlanticus

Here is the WoRMS entry:
http://www.marinespecies.org/aphia.p...ails&id=140022

Edit:
According to this article (http://www.seaslugforum.net/find/glauatla) they feed almost exclusively on Physalia (hydroids). It is probably not a good choice for an aquarium, as food could be in short supply (unless one has a booming population of colonial hydroids . . . though I think these guys prefer the Portuguese Man of War).
